A group of ten UIC professors each contributed an equal amount to the purchase of a State of Illinois Lottery ticket. Two of the
Bogdan [553]

Answer:

Total cost of Ticket = $96

Explanation:

Provided information,

Total number of people buying lottery ticket in a joint contribution = 10

Two people withdraw being short of funds, therefore people buying such ticket = 8

Revised share increase by $2.40 each.

Total increase = $2.40 \times 8 = $19.20

Just because 2 people withdraw, thus earlier contribution per person = $19.20/2 = $9.60

Therefore, total cost of ticket = $9.60 \times 10 = $96
